Can I advertise wine on Facebook?
You can’t sell wine ON Facebook. Facebook has a cool function for non-alcohol brands to upload products directly onto Facebook and sell directly from the platform. Many wineries successfully advertise both their wine products and promote winery visits with paid media on the social network.

Can I sell wine in Facebook?
No. Facebook’s Commerce Policies page advises that posts on Marketplace may not promote the sale of alcohol. So, whilst Facebook is an excellent tool for increasing your business advertising platform through social media, selling wine or alcohol direct to the consumer (DTC/D2C) is illegal.
Who consumes wine the most?
The United States
The United States consumes the largest volume of wine of any country, at 33 million hectoliters in 2020. At 24.7 million hectoliters, France was the second leading consumer of wine worldwide.
